Abstract
The present invention relates generally to a functional shoe having spaced front and rear outsoles. More particularly, the present invention relates to a functional shoe having spaced front and rear outsoles, the functional shoe providing comfort to a user by being flexibly deformed to conform to a shape or walking form of a user's foot during walking, and guiding a tandem gait by allowing a front portion of the foot to be leaned inward while allowing an inside portion of the foot to be leaned inward at the moment when the foot contacts the ground during walking.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A functional shoe having spaced front and rear outsoles, the functional shoe comprising:
a base plate ( 100 ) formed in a shape conforming to a foot; an upper body ( 200 ) coupled to a lower surface of the base plate ( 100 ) such that a flexible part ( 210 ) entirely covering a middle portion of the lower surface of the base plate ( 100 ) is formed, and front and rear through-holes ( 220 a and 220 b ) covering only edges of the lower surface of the base plate ( 100 ) are formed at in front of and behind the flexible part ( 210 ), the upper body being configured to cover the foot to be placed on an upper side of the base plate ( 100 ); and an outsole ( 310 ) supporting the foot, and including a front outsole ( 310 ) coupled to cover the front through-hole ( 220 a ), and a rear outsole ( 320 ) coupled to cover the rear through-hole ( 220 b ) at a position spaced apart from the front outsole ( 310 ), wherein the front outsole ( 310 ) includes multiple line grooves ( 311 ) recessed in an upper surface thereof in a bar shape and arranged along a width direction, a bending groove ( 312 ) recessed concavely is formed in a lower surface of the front outsole ( 310 ) by extending transversely along the width direction at a boundary point between a portion where toes of the foot are located and a portion where a sole of the foot is located, and the bending groove is disposed alternately with the line grooves ( 311 ) in a zigzag arrangement, the outsole ( 300 ) includes multiple air holes ( 10 ) formed in an upper surface thereof at a predetermined depth, and the air holes ( 10 ) are provided such that more air holes are formed at a point of the outsole ( 300 ) that supports an inside portion of the sole than a point that supports an outside portion of the sole.
2 . The functional shoe of claim 1 , wherein the air holes ( 10 ) are formed in the front outsole ( 310 ) at areas approximately in front of or behind opposite ends of the line grooves ( 311 ), except for an area between the bending groove ( 312 ) and the line grooves ( 311 ) adjacent thereto.
3 . The functional shoe of claim 1 , wherein the rear outsole ( 320 ) is formed in a concave shape in which a rear edge and opposite side edges of an upper portion protrude and a support surface ( 321 ) is formed on an inside surface of the upper portion, and
a cushioning part ( 322 ) having a predetermined shape is provided at a middle portion of the support surface ( 321 ) by protruding lower than the rear edge and opposite side edges of the upper portion of the rear outsole ( 320 ).
4 . The functional shoe of claim 3 , wherein the cushioning part ( 322 ) is configured such that middle portions of an edge thereof are connected to the support surface ( 321 ) in opposite directions and an air line ( 20 ) is formed along a remaining portion of the edge at a predetermined depth.
5 . The functional shoe of claim 4 , wherein each of the air holes ( 10 ) and the air line ( 20 ) includes an air chamber ( 30 ) formed in an interior of the outsole ( 300 ) to form a predetermined space that is larger in width than an inlet in longitudinal sectional view.
6 . The functional shoe of claim 3 , wherein the cushioning part ( 322 ) is formed to have a longer length at the point that supports the inside portion of the sole than the point that supports the outside portion of the sole.
7 . A functional shoe having spaced front and rear outsoles, the functional shoe comprising:
a base plate ( 100 ) formed in a shape conforming to a foot; an upper body ( 200 ) coupled to a lower surface of the base plate ( 100 ) such that a flexible part ( 210 ) entirely covering a middle portion of the lower surface of the base plate ( 100 ) is formed and front and rear through-holes ( 220 a and 220 b ) covering only edges of the lower surface of the base plate ( 100 ) are formed in front of and behind the flexible part ( 210 ), and configured to cover the foot to be placed on an upper side of the base plate ( 100 ); and an outsole ( 310 ) supporting the foot, and including a front outsole ( 310 ) coupled to cover the front through-hole ( 220 a ), and a rear outsole ( 320 ) coupled to cover the rear through-hole ( 220 b ) at a position spaced apart from the front outsole ( 310 ), wherein the front outsole ( 310 ) includes multiple line grooves ( 311 ) recessed in an upper surface thereof in a bar shape and arranged along a width direction, a conical pivot protrusion ( 323 ) is formed on an outer upper surface with respect to a center line of the rear outsole ( 320 ), a spring groove ( 324 ) is formed in a lower upper surface with respect to a center line of the cushioning part ( 322 ), and a spring ( 325 ) is inserted into the spring groove ( 324 ), an upward inclined protrusion ( 313 ) having a right-angled triangular shape in which an inclined surface thereof faces inward of the front outsole ( 310 ) is formed on an outer upper surface with respect to a center line of the front outsole ( 310 ), a spring groove ( 314 ) is formed in an inner upper surface with respect to the center line of the front outsole ( 310 ), and a spring ( 315 ) is inserted into the spring groove ( 314 ), at front and rear inner and outer portions of the base plate ( 100 ), a pivot protrusion passage hole ( 101 ) through which the pivot protrusion ( 323 ) passes, an inclined protrusion passage hole ( 102 ) through which the upward inclined protrusion ( 313 ) passes, and spring passage holes ( 103 and 104 ) through which the front and rear springs ( 315 and 325 ) pass, respectively, are formed through the base plate, and on a lower surface of an insole ( 110 ) placed on the base plate ( 100 ) in an insertable and detachable manner, a downward inclined protrusion ( 111 ) having a right-angled triangular shape in which an inclined surface thereof faces outward is formed to protrude downward corresponding to the upward inclined protrusion ( 313 ).
8 . The functional shoe of claim 7 , wherein the spring ( 325 ) is provided such that an upper end thereof protrudes by a height corresponding to a height of an upper end of the pivot protrusion ( 323 ), and the spring ( 315 ) is provided such that an upper end thereof protrudes by a height corresponding to a height of an upper end of the upward inclined protrusion ( 313 ), and
